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Christine Wong conducted an unannounced annual visit at the facility. LPA met with Karina De La Rosa - Program Director and explained the reason for the visit.

Facility is licensed to served 60 adults which 54 adults ambulatory and 6 adults non-ambulatory. Facility serves an adult day program capacity and is currently serving clients virtually and partially in person due to COVID 19. Facility has a lobby/clients' lockers, a conference room, 5 staff offices, a media room, a game room, a quiet room, staff break room, kitchen/client break room, a storage room, a janitor room, art and craft room, a gym room, computer room and three unisex restrooms and one male restroom.

LPA conducted a tour of the facility with the program director and observed the following:
Restrooms water temperature were tested between 109 and 109.6 degrees F which is within the 105 - 120 degrees F. Facility has a fire sprinkle system, and 4 fire extinguishers were observed throughout the facility.
Facility's first aid kit is stored in the program director office and has required items and each group also has their own first aid kit. All the knives and sharp utensils are locked in the program director office and the cleaning supplies are stored and locked in the storage/janitor room which is inaccessible to the clients.

Facility is currently following COVID 19 recommendations regarding COVID 19 signs throughout the facility, For social distancing, each common activity room has a sign and indicated certain number of people allowed in each room, disinfecting products are available in each room and facility is disinfected every day by staff and a cleaning crew also comes every day to disinfect the whole facility. All restrooms have sufficient soap, paper towels, and hand-washing signs. PPE supplies are sufficient for more than 30 days.

No deficiencies were found during this visit. Exit interview was conducted with program Karina De La Rosa and a copy of this report was provided.
